#992728 color RGB value is (153,39,40). #992728 color name is Custom Color color.

#992728 hex color red value is 153, green value is 39 and the blue value of its RGB is 40.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#992728 hue: 1.00, saturation: 0.59 and the lightness value of 992728 is 0.38.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#992728 color hex is 0.00, 0.75, 0.74, 0.40. Web safe color of #992728 is #993333. Color #992728 contains mainly RED color.

About #992728 Custom Color

#992728 (Custom Color) is a red-based color with RGB values of 153, 39, 40. This color belongs to the red color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#992728,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#992728 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#992728), RGB (rgb(153, 39, 40)), HSL (hsl(359, 59%, 38%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#993333,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
